Probability Density Function

A Probability Density Function (PDF) is a fundamental concept in probability theory and statistics, defining the relative likelihood for a continuous random variable to take on a given value. The integral of the PDF over an interval yields the probability that the variable falls within that interval.

Frequently Asked Questions

What is a probability density function?+
It is a special graph that shows how likely a continuous value is. The higher the part of the graph, the more likely the value is to be near that point.
Why do continuous variables use a PDF instead of a PMF?+
Because continuous variables can take infinitely many values, so the chance of any exact value is zero. A PDF gives the density over ranges instead of single points.
How do we find the probability that a value falls between two numbers?+
We add up (integrate) the PDF over that interval. The area under the curve between the two numbers is the probability.
What are the two rules a PDF must follow?+
The PDF must never be negative. The total area under its curve over all possible values must equal 1.
Where do people use PDFs in real life?+
They help model things like measurement errors, heights of people, signals, and financial data, so scientists can predict and plan.
